Types of Training Programs in Command Center Simulation

Command Center Simulation Training encompasses various training programs designed to enhance operational effectiveness in military command centers. These programs typically focus on strategic, tactical, and operational decision-making processes through simulated environments that mimic real-world scenarios.

One common type involves Live-Virtual-Constructive (LVC) training, which integrates live exercises with virtual systems and constructive simulations. This approach allows personnel to engage in comprehensive exercises that enhance their understanding of multi-domain operations.

Another significant program is the use of Computer-Assisted Exercises (CAX), where computer simulations help recreate complex environments. CAX is particularly useful for analyzing decision-making processes and improving situational awareness among command center personnel.

Lastly, Command Post Exercises (CPX) simulate actual command and control environment operations. These exercises enable military leaders to practice coordinating responses, assess command structures, and improve collaborative efforts in real-time, thus bolstering the effectiveness of Command Center Simulation Training.

Challenges in Command Center Simulation Training

Command Center Simulation Training faces several challenges that can impede its effectiveness. One significant challenge is the high cost associated with developing and maintaining the necessary hardware and software. Maintaining state-of-the-art technology demands continuous funding and expertise, which can strain military budgets.

Another challenge lies in the complexity of creating realistic scenarios. Training simulations must accurately replicate real-world conditions to ensure that personnel can transfer learned skills to actual operations. This requires a deep understanding of tactical environments and access to historical data, adding layers to the planning process.

Additionally, effective training depends heavily on participant engagement. Resistance to adopting new technologies or unfamiliar training methods can lead to decreased morale and participation. Ensuring that military personnel remain motivated and involved in Command Center Simulation Training is crucial for maximizing its benefits.

Finally, integrating multi-disciplinary teams poses a further challenge. The need for cohesive communication and collaboration among various branches and expertise levels complicates the training process, often requiring tailored solutions to promote a unified operational capability.

Measuring Effectiveness of Command Center Simulation Training

Measuring the effectiveness of Command Center Simulation Training involves evaluating the extent to which training programs meet their intended learning objectives. This assessment is critical to understanding the impact on military readiness and operational efficiency.

Assessment methods typically include performance metrics, such as response times and decision accuracy during simulations. Another aspect involves participant feedback, collecting insights from trainees about their experiences and perceived improvements. This qualitative data complements quantitative measures, providing a comprehensive view of training efficacy.

Furthermore, conducting after-action reviews can illuminate strengths and areas for improvement in command performance. These reviews focus on how effectively teams collaborated in simulated crisis scenarios, directly linking simulation outcomes to real-world military operations.

Integrating analytics tools within command center simulations allows for ongoing data collection. Continuous performance tracking enables adjustments to training scenarios, further enhancing the effectiveness of Command Center Simulation Training and ensuring that armed forces remain prepared for various operational challenges.
